The difficulty of being an urbanist right now is that we need TWO urban strategies: 1. Knowledge industry led growth for declining regions 2. Affordable housing for cities where knowledge industries have pushed up rents It's really hard to make this one compelling message.
It's not that hard when you realize that (1) bad zoning meant to favor a certain kind of single-family home, middle class lifestyle and (2) overly complex/onerous regulations that leave big developers in the catbird seat are keeping both types of cities from adjusting
